1 change: 1 addition & 0 deletions doc/source/whatsnew/v0.19.0.txt
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-439,6 +439,7 @@ Deprecations
- ``buffer_lines`` has been deprecated in ``pd.read_csv()`` and will be removed in a future version (:issue:`13360`)
- ``as_recarray`` has been deprecated in ``pd.read_csv()`` and will be removed in a future version (:issue:`13373`)
- top-level ``pd.ordered_merge()`` has been renamed to ``pd.merge_ordered()`` and the original name will be removed in a future version (:issue:`13358`)
- ``Timestamp`` ``offset`` option and property has been deprecated in favor of ``freq`` (:issue:`12160`)

15 changes: 15 additions & 0 deletions pandas/tseries/tests/test_tslib.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-255,6 +255,21 @@ def test_constructor_keyword(self):
hour=1, minute=2, second=3, microsecond=999999)),
repr(Timestamp('2015-11-12 01:02:03.999999')))

def test_constructor_offset_depr(self):
# GH 12160
with tm.assert_produces_warning(FutureWarning,
check_stacklevel=False):
ts = Timestamp('2011-01-01', offset='D')
self.assertEqual(ts.freq, 'D')

with tm.assert_produces_warning(FutureWarning,
check_stacklevel=False):
self.assertEqual(ts.offset, 'D')

msg = "Can only specify freq or offset, not both"
with tm.assertRaisesRegexp(TypeError, msg):
Timestamp('2011-01-01', freq='D', offset='D')
